Dr. Heather Melichar is an Associate Professor in the Department of Medicine at the University of Montreal, where she leads a research group at the Maisonneuve-Rosemont Hospital Research Center. With a PhD from the University of Massachusetts Medical School and postdoctoral training at UC Berkeley, her work focuses on the cellular and molecular mechanisms regulating T cell development and function, particularly through thymic microenvironment interactions.
- Doctoral: University of Massachusetts Medical School (Dr. Joonsoo Kang lab)
- Postdoctoral: University of California, Berkeley (Dr. Ellen Robey lab)
Her research employs advanced techniques like multiparameter flow cytometry, two-photon microscopy, and genetically modified mouse models to investigate:
- TCR selection thresholds during thymocyte development
- Age-related differences in thymic selection
- Role of tissue-restricted antigens in mTEC
- Tumor-immune cell interactions via novel protein-protein signaling
Key article trends reveal sustained focus on developmental immunology, with recent expansions into neuroimmunology, metabolic disorders, and tumor immunology. Her 2023-2025 work includes translational studies on navitoclax therapy and epigenetic impacts of early-life infections.
Scientific awards include FRSQ and CIHR fellowships. Current grants support investigations into vitamin D signaling in thymic aging and tumor-immune crosstalk.
She supervises graduate students and postdoctoral fellows in laboratory projects, while co-supervising with interdisciplinary collaborators in genetics and oncology.
